Description
Human Vaccines & Immunotherapeutics is a peer-reviewed journal covering basic and applied research related to vaccines and immunotherapeutics. The journal explores innovative approaches to prevent and treat diseases through immunization and immune modulation. The publication includes studies related to vaccines, microbiology and vaccinology. Topics covered range from basic research like immunology, proteomics, and viral hepatitis to clinical applications including vaccine development, and the study of infectious diseases. Human Vaccines & Immunotherapeutics is indexed in key databases, targeting immunologists, virologists, public health professionals, and vaccine developers. The journal focuses on open access to research articles to accelerate advancements in vaccine technology. The journal publishes research that can aid in the development of vaccines for immunotherapeutics and supports global health initiatives.
